Teacher Quarters, School Canteen Destroyed in Tongod Fire

Fire razes teachers’ quarters at SK Imbak, Tongod, leaving only debris and twisted metal structures. —Photo by JBPM

KINABATANGAN — Two blocks of teachers’ quarters, a school canteen and a car were destroyed in a fire at SK Imbak, Tongod, yesterday evening.

The Sabah Fire and Rescue Department received an emergency call at 6.24pm and mobilised personnel from the Kinabatangan Fire and Rescue Station, assisted by the Tongod Volunteer Fire Brigade.

The volunteer team arrived at the scene at 7.54pm, about 167km from the station.

Operations commander PB Saripuddin Ali Hassan said the fire involved two blocks of teachers’ quarters comprising four units.

“A school canteen and a Proton Saga BLM car were also destroyed,” he said.

The blaze was brought under control at 11.05pm and operations ended at 11.18pm.

Members of the public had earlier put out the fire using private water pumps and water from a public tank before firefighters arrived. Firefighters later inspected the area to ensure there were no further hazards.

No casualties were reported in the incident.
